The book considers human rights approaches to crimes from a theoretical and practical perspective, analyses various crimes under international law, and examines the application, implementation and enforcement of international criminal law.

Borhan Uddin Khan, Ph.D., School of Oriental and African Studies (SOAS), University of London, is currently a Professor in the Department of Law, University of Dhaka. His recently coedited book publication is: Revisiting the Geneva Conventions: 1949-2019 (Brill/Nijhoff, 2020). Md Jahid Hossain Bhuiyan, Ph.D., University of Queensland, Australia, is currently a Humboldt research fellow at the Max Planck Institute for Comparative Public Law and International Law, Germany. He is the co-editor of Revisiting the Geneva Conventions: 1949-2019 (Brill/Nijhoff, 2020).
